POST api/Dev/Trg/New

添加一个新的触发器定义。

Request Information

URI Parameters

None.

Body Parameters

触发器的内容。

DevTrgParm
NameDescriptionTypeAdditional information
trgname

触发器名称

string

None.

usage

触发器的用途说明。

string

None.

usable

触发器是否启用,1表示启用,0表示停用。

string

None.

sqldefine

sql定义。

string

None.

Request Formats

application/json, text/json

Sample:
{
  "trgname": "sample string 1",
  "usage": "sample string 2",
  "usable": "sample string 3",
  "sqldefine": "sample string 4"
}

application/xml, text/xml

Sample:
<DevTrgParm x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/DigitalScience.DataTransfer.Dosimeter">
  <sqldefine>sample string 4</sqldefine>
  <trgname>sample string 1</trgname>
  <usable>sample string 3</usable>
  <usage>sample string 2</usage>
</DevTrgParm>

application/x-www-form-urlencoded

Sample:

Sample not available.

application/bson

Sample:
Binary JSON content. See http://bsonspec.org for details.

Response Information

Resource Description

添加一个新的触发器定义。

CommonOperationResultWithTagOfInt64
NameDescriptionTypeAdditional information
errcode

integer

None.

errmsg

string

None.

tag

integer

None.

Response Formats

application/json, text/json

Sample:
{
  "errcode": 1,
  "errmsg": "sample string 2",
  "tag": 3
}

application/xml, text/xml

Sample:
<CommonOperationResultWithTagOflong x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/DigitalScience.DataTransfer">
  <errcode>1</errcode>
  <errmsg>sample string 2</errmsg>
  <tag>3</tag>
</CommonOperationResultWithTagOflong>

application/bson

Sample:
Binary JSON content. See http://bsonspec.org for details.